First in Europe to acquire NVIDIA H200 GPUs – currently the most powerful GPUs on the market The deployment further expands the Group’s Generative AI CSP offering, already the largest in Europe Further demonstration of the Group’s continued commitment to providing best-in-class technologies FRANKFURT, Germany, July 1, 2024 /PRNewswire/ — Northern Data Group (Ticker symbol German stock market: NB2, ISIN: DE000A0SMU87), a leading provider of High-Performance Computing (HPC) solutions, today announces it has purchased NVIDIA H200 GPUs through a newly established partnership with Supermicro, a global leader in Application-Optimized Total IT Solutions.

Northern Data Group’s cloud platform, Taiga Cloud will be the first Cloud Service Provider (CSP) in Europe to offer access to the H200 GPU hardware, with delivery and deployment scheduled for Q4 2024. The partnership with Supermicro for the NVIDIA H200 GPUs will further build its HPC solutions and complement its existing offering of best-in-class GenAI technologies.
This purchase of the H200 GPUs demonstrates Northern Data Group’s commitment to offering the best-in-class technology to its customers, as it continues to expand its cloud solutions offering, while also maintaining its position as Europe’s first and largest dedicated Generative AI Cloud Service Provider.
The first full island of over 2,000 NVIDIA H200 GPUs utilizing BlueField-3 data processing units (DPUs) and NVIDIA Mellanox CX7 NICs, to deliver 32 petaFLOPS of performance. The configuration of NVIDIA-referenced architecture allows customers to access more bandwidth, faster, and more efficient data storage access. The H200 GPUs will be housed in one of Northern Data Group’s European data centers, powered by carbon-free, renewable energy and boast a Power Usage Effectiveness ratio of less than 1.2.

COPENHAGEN, Denmark, July 1, 2024 /PRNewswire/ — Dawn Health, the digital health company pioneering patient-first innovation, has announced they are working with leading global pharmaceutical company, Merck, on a digital solution for Growth Hormone Disorders (GHD).

Over the next two years, they will join forces to deliver a cutting-edge, user-centric digital platform, designed to help improve the lives of tens of thousands of patients across more than 40 countries.
By harnessing the latest AI technologies, the collaboration will also involve exploring the integration of features such as growth predictions and advanced personalization into the digital product, with excitement about AI and its potential for impact on user experience, adoption, adherence, and treatment outcomes. The digital solution will provide support to children and young adults living with GHD, as well as providing tools and support to their caregivers, both at home and in a clinical setting. 
With a shared commitment to improving patient lives, the collaboration will focus on patient-centricity to deliver an intuitive, engaging product that supports users and caregivers throughout their treatment journey. This means speaking with patients to truly understand their unmet needs and how the solution can best address these, as well as hearing from caregivers and healthcare professionals about how to best empower and support those living with GHD.

DALIAN, China, July 1, 2024 /PRNewswire/ — “AI in healthcare is extremely challenging. For companies, it requires not only solving scientific problems but also understanding AI technology and respecting the complexity of the healthcare industry.” At the 15th Annual Meeting of the New Champions, also known as Summer Davos, Ms. Gong Rujing (Yingying), Chairwoman and Founder of Yidu Tech, was invited as a distinguished representative of the healthcare technology sector. She shared her unique insights into the future of AI in healthcare during the thematic dialogue on “Healthcare Analytics, Not Moving Fast Enough.”

This year marks the 10th anniversary of Yidu Tech and Ms. Gong Rujing’s decade-long dedication to the healthcare industry. From the inception of her entrepreneurial journey 10 years ago, she has been driven by the mission to leverage the power of technology to deliver precise healthcare to every individual.
Ms. Gong described the past decade as a journey filled with miracles and achievements. During this period, Yidu Tech has progressively established close collaborations with key stakeholders in the healthcare industry, including government agencies, hospitals, pharmaceutical companies, insurance firms, experts, and clinicians. As of March 31, 2024, Yidu Tech’s “AI Medical Brain” YiduCore has been authorized to process and analyze over 5 billion medical records, covering more than 2,500 hospitals.
In AI-powered clinical research, Yidu Tech has supported researchers and clinicians in producing over 240 high-level papers, accelerating the application of research outcomes. Additionally, Yidu Tech provides clinical trial services to globally renowned pharmaceutical companies, helping them optimize trial processes, reduce costs, and bring new drugs to market more swiftly, ultimately benefiting patients. In healthcare management, Yidu Tech’s AI technology plays a crucial role by analyzing vast amounts of medical data to provide comprehensive decision support to healthcare administrators, helping them optimize resource allocation and improve service efficiency.
